handmaidenhood

English

Etymology

handmaiden +? -hood

Noun

handmaidenhood (uncountable)

  1. (rare) The state or condition of being a handmaiden; also the role of a handmaiden.

handmaiden

English

Etymology

hand +? maiden, the first component in the sense of "ready at hand".

Noun

handmaiden (plural handmaidens)

  1. Alternative form of handmaid

Derived terms

  • handmaidenhood
  • handmaidenly
